We are seeking a Senior Operations Engineer (Data & Network) to support the performance, security, and reliability of a large-scale Electronic Health Record Modernization (EHRM) system.

This role is hands-on and mission-critical—focused on network monitoring, system performance, server optimization, and security compliance across enterprise environments supporting healthcare operations.

You’ll work across both Windows and Linux environments, ensuring system stability, identifying anomalies, and maintaining compliance with federal security standards.

Key Responsibilities

Network & System Monitoring

  • Analyze LAN/WAN traffic across enterprise environments to detect anomalies and performance issues
  • Generate performance reports (bandwidth, latency, application behavior) using tools like NetScout
  • Monitor and validate encryption of network traffic and system communications

️ Systems Administration & Performance

  • Validate and monitor Windows and Linux system logs
  • Oversee system upgrades, patching, and configuration validation (Windows Server & Red Hat Linux)
  • Troubleshoot and optimize server performance across environments

⚙️ Infrastructure & High Availability

  • Optimize NIC teaming and network redundancy configurations
  • Analyze and maintain Windows Clustering for high availability
  • Ensure SAN-connected systems are configured with Multipath IO for redundancy and performance

Security & Compliance

  • Support vulnerability management (Nessus scans, POA&M updates)
  • Ensure systems meet ATO/ATC requirements and federal security standards
  • Implement and validate STIG-based hardening across physical and virtual systems
  • Validate authentication integrations (e.g., Centrify, PIV card access)

Monitoring & Tools Integration

  • Ensure systems are properly integrated into monitoring tools (SCOM, SolarWinds)
  • Perform daily reviews of logs, alerts, and system health metrics
  • Provide recommendations for optimization and risk mitigation

Required Skills:
  • Bachelor’s Degree in a technical field
  • Strong experience with:
    • Network traffic analysis (LAN/WAN environments)
    • Windows Server (2012/2016+) and Red Hat Linux systems
    • Enterprise monitoring tools (NetScout, SCOM, SolarWinds, or similar)
  • Experience with:
    • System patching, upgrades, and configuration management
    • Server performance tuning and troubleshooting
    • Security compliance frameworks (STIG, ATO, vulnerability management)


Preferred Skills:
  • Experience supporting EHR or large-scale healthcare systems
  • Familiarity with:
    • Windows Clustering & high availability environments
    • SAN architecture & Multipath IO
    • Centrify or similar authentication tools
  • Experience supporting live system deployments and sustainment environments
  • Prior experience in federal or regulated environments
